摘 要:根据重油结构成分,选取甲苯代表芳香烃化合物,正庚烷代表烷烃类化合物,丙烯代表烯烃类化合物,构建重油替代物机理模型。采用Chemkin软件使用DRG方法对其简化,同时进行敏感性分析,得到简化机理。对简化机理进行滞燃期与层流火焰速度的验证,验证简化机理的合理性。将其耦合得到121组分、700个基元反应的重油替代物简化机理。ccording to the structure and composition of heavy oil,the mechanism model of heavy oil substitutes was constructed by choosing toluene as the aromatic compound,n-heptane as the alkane compound and propylene as the olefin compound.Chemkin software was used to simplify it by DRG method,and sensitivity analysis was carried out to obtain the simplified mechanism.The ignition delay and laminar flame speed of the simplified mechanism are verified to verify the rationality of the simplified mechanism.A simplified mechanism of heavy oil substitutes with 121 components and 700 elementary reactions was obtained by coupling them.
